ATR Study of the Ionizing Characteristics of 4-Heptadecyl-7-hydroxycoumarin in Cast Monolayer Films

Abstract
UV ATR spectroscopy has been used to investigate the pH titration characteristics of cast monolayer films of 4-heptadecyl-7-hydroxycoumarin. At high charge densities (>8 μC/cm2) the pH titration characteristics of the ionizing surface film resemble the profile generated from simple Gouy-Chapman (GC) theory. At low charge densities (<8 μC/cm2) significant deviation from GC theory is observed—minima in the measured pKa vs. surface charge density plots were obtained. Titrations conducted on monolayers which had been cast under a variety of conditions produced virtually identical results, implying that titration minima were not due to peculiarities in the physical character of the cast film.
